- Установка Anbox и запуск программ для Android в Linux
- Установка Anbox
- Заголовки разделов
- Установка Anbox с помощью Snap
- Установка ADB
- Установка ADB в Ubuntu и Debian
- Установка ADB в Fedora
- Установка ADB в Arch Linux
- Установка приложений в Anbox
- Скачивание APK
- Подключение к Anbox
- Установка приложения
- Заключение
- Как установить Anbox на Linux Mint 20
- Как установить Anbox на Linux Mint 20
- Установить Anbox на Linux Mint 20 Ulyana
- Шаг 1. Перед запуском приведенного ниже руководства важно убедиться, что ваша система обновлена, выполнив следующие apt команды в терминале:
- Шаг 2. Установка Snap.
- Шаг 3. Установка модулей ядра.
- Шаг 4. Установка Anbox на Linux Mint 20.
- Шаг 5. Доступ к Anbox в Linux Mint.
- Как запускать приложения и игры для Android в Linux
- Встречайте Anbox, ваш «Android в коробке»
- Какие Linux дистрибутивы поддерживают Snap?
- Установка Anbox в Linux
- Загрузка файлов APK на компьютер с Linux
- Установка приложений Android в Linux с помощью Anbox
- Теперь вы можете запустить Android APK на Linux
Установка Anbox и запуск программ для Android в Linux
Оригинал: How To Install Anbox and Run Android Apps In Linux
Автор: Nick Congleton
Дата публикации: 4 февраля 2019 года
Перевод: А. Кривошей
Дата перевода: апрель 2019 г.
Anbox — это достаточно новый инструмент, который действует как прослойка между вашим дистрибутивом Linux и нативными приложениями для Android. Он позволяет вам использовать многие приложения, как если бы они работали на вашем компьютере. Хотя Anbox все еще находится в стадии разработки, вы можете начать работу с ним прямо сейчас и попробовать некоторые из ваших любимых приложений для Android.
Установка Anbox
Anbox приобрел некоторую популярность в основных дистрибутивах Linux. В результате вы можете найти его в некоторых репозиториях. Тем не менее, самым простым способом являются snaps. Оцените имеющиеся варианты и выберите наиболее подходящий для вас.
Установка Anbox в Ubuntu или Debian:
Anbox недавно был добавлен в репозитории Ubuntu и Debian. Если вы используете Debian Buster или Ubuntu Cosmic, у вас будет доступ к Anbox с помощью Apt. В противном случае перейдите к разделу snap.
Заголовки разделов
Установка Anbox в Arch Linux:
Anbox доступен в AUR. Вы можете установить его вручную или с помощью AUR helper.
С AUR helper процесс значительно упрощается.
Установка Anbox с помощью Snap
Snaps по-прежнему являются предпочтительным способом установки Anbox, и они являются единственным реальным вариантом в большинстве дистрибутивов. Убедитесь, что в вашей системе установлен и запущен snapd, и выполните следующую команду:
Вам, вероятно, придется перезагрузиться, чтобы заставить Anbox работать. Потребуется загрузить несколько модулей ядра.
Установка ADB
Вы можете запустить Anbox прямо сейчас, но инструменты, которые идут с ним, довольно ограничены. К сожалению, Google Play Store не является одним из таких инструментов. В результате вам понадобится Android Debug Bridge (ADB), чтобы вручную загружать APK-файлы Android в вашу виртуальную установку Android в Anbox. Эти инструменты легко доступны в большинстве дистрибутивов, поэтому вам не составит труда их получить.
Установка ADB в Ubuntu и Debian
Google разработал эти инструменты для Ubuntu, поэтому их очень легко установить в Ubuntu и Debian.
Установка ADB в Fedora
Инструменты для Android также несложно установить в Fedora. Они доступны в репозитории по умолчанию.
Установка ADB в Arch Linux
Arch Linux также имеет эти инструменты в репозиториях.
Установка приложений в Anbox
Хотя вы не можете использовать Play Store для загрузки приложений на Anbox, вы можете получить APK-файлы Android с таких сайтов, как APKMirror , и вручную отправить их в Anbox с помощью ADB.
Скачивание APK
Откройте браузер и перейдите в APKMirror. Вы заметите, что справа есть функция поиска. Используйте его для поиска приложения, которое вы хотите попробовать. Не выбирайте ничего, что потребует сервисов Google. Они не будут работать, так как в Anbox отсутствуют сервисы Google Play. Кроме того, не забудьте найти x86 APK. Хотя вы эмулируете Android, вы все еще используете обычный 64-битный процессор, а не ARM.
Подключение к Anbox
Пришло время запустить Anbox. Это графическое приложение, поэтому вы можете найти его в панели запуска приложений. Когда Anbox откроется, вы увидите окно с простым списком приложений Android. Вы можете попробовать щелкнуть по нему, чтобы открыть его. Это все довольно примитивно, но это работает.
Откройте терминал и выполните приведенную ниже команду, чтобы запустить сервер ADB.
Сервер ADB запустится и отобразит Anbox как эмулированное устройство. Теперь вы готовы установить приложение.
Установка приложения
Найдите APK, который вы загрузили. Затем выполните следующую команду, чтобы установить его в Anbox.
Это займет несколько секунд, но когда это будет сделано, ваше приложение появится в списке Anbox. Это может работать, а может и нет. Anbox пока не является идеальным решением для эмуляции.
Заключение
Anbox — отличный способ опробовать приложения для Android на вашем ПК с Linux. Он пока не готов к ежедневному использованию и, конечно, не является системой производственного уровня. Тем не менее, вы можете делать некоторые действительно интересные вещи с Anbox, и он может быть отличным инструментом для разработчиков Android.
Источник
Как установить Anbox на Linux Mint 20
Как установить Anbox на Linux Mint 20
В этом руководстве мы покажем вам, как установить Anbox на Linux Mint 20. Для тех из вас, кто не знал, Anbox — это сокращение от Android в коробке, Anbox — это бесплатная среда с открытым исходным кодом, которая позволяет запускать Приложения Android в вашем дистрибутиве Linux. Он предлагает уровень совместимости, выполняя среду выполнения Android для выполнения приложений Android. Есть и другие проекты Android для Linux, такие как Shashlik или Genymotion. Разница в том, что эти проекты полагаются на эмулятор для запуска необходимой среды Android, которая активирует всю эмулируемую систему с ее собственным ядром. С другой стороны, Anbox запускает систему Android непосредственно на ядре Linux.
В этой статье предполагается, что у вас есть хотя бы базовые знания Linux, вы знаете, как использовать оболочку, и, что наиболее важно, вы размещаете свой сайт на собственном VPS. Установка довольно проста и предполагает, что вы работаете с учетной записью root, в противном случае вам может потребоваться добавить ‘ sudo ‘ к командам для получения привилегий root. Я покажу вам пошаговую установку эмулятора Android Anbox на Linux Mint 20 (Ульяна).
Установить Anbox на Linux Mint 20 Ulyana
Шаг 1. Перед запуском приведенного ниже руководства важно убедиться, что ваша система обновлена, выполнив следующие apt команды в терминале:
Шаг 2. Установка Snap.
Выполните следующую команду, чтобы установить пакеты Snap:
После этого нужно вручную загрузить модули ядра:
Шаг 3. Установка модулей ядра.
Перед установкой Anbox необходимо установить модули ядра. Это необходимо для поддержки обязательных подсистем ядра ashmem и binder для контейнера Android:
Шаг 4. Установка Anbox на Linux Mint 20.
Чтобы установить Anbox, просто используйте следующую команду:
Для получения информации о привязке Anbox используется команда:
Шаг 5. Доступ к Anbox в Linux Mint.
Перейдите в меню приложения через Меню и найдите Anbox.
Поздравляю! Вы успешно установили Anbox . Благодарим за использование этого руководства для установки последней версии Anbox в системе Linux Mint. Для получения дополнительной помощи или полезной информации мы рекомендуем вам посетить официальный сайт Anbox .
Источник
Как запускать приложения и игры для Android в Linux
Хотите запускать приложения для Android в Linux? Как насчет игр на Android? Доступно несколько вариантов, но лучше всего работает Anbox. Это инструмент, который запускает ваши любимые приложения для Android в Linux без эмуляции.
Вот как использовать Anbox для запуска приложений Android на вашем ПК с Linux сегодня.
Встречайте Anbox, ваш «Android в коробке»
Доступ к вашим любимым приложениям и играм для Android приносит Linux новое захватывающее измерение производительности. Мобильные приложения по дизайну намного проще, чем в настольных операционных системах.
Это может быть именно то, что вы ищете для повышения производительности рабочего стола!
Тем временем мобильные игры становятся все более изощренными. Это имеет смысл, что вы можете продолжить играть на другом устройстве. Это особенно верно, учитывая ограниченное время автономной работы телефона или планшета.
Для запуска приложений Android (например, Bluestacks) доступно несколько инструментов macOS и Windows, но это не доступно для Linux.
Вместо этого пользователи Linux должны попробовать Anboxбесплатный инструмент с открытым исходным кодом для запуска приложений Android в Linux. Он основан на последней версии Android Open Source Project (AOSP) и предлагает оконную среду Android.
Anbox использует контейнеры для отделения Android от операционной системы хоста, что позволяет запускать игры для Android в Linux
Это не все; Anbox не имеет ограничений, поэтому теоретически вы можете запустить любое приложение для Android в Linux. Здесь также нет аппаратной виртуализации, поэтому Anbox также работает на ноутбуке или настольном компьютере, независимо от спецификации системы.
Какие Linux дистрибутивы поддерживают Snap?
Anbox поставляется бесплатно, хотя и бесплатен. Это означает, что двоичный файл и все зависимости включены в один пакет, что упрощает установку. К сожалению, это означает, что ваша ОС Linux не может использовать Anbox, если она не может распаковывать и устанавливать снимки.
snapd Сервис необходим для установки моментальных снимков, и это совместимо с дистрибутивами Linux, такими как:
- Arch Linux
- Debian
- мягкая фетровая шляпа
- Gentoo
- Linux Mint
- Manjaro
- OpenSUSE
- в единственном числе
- Ubuntu
В Ubuntu Snapd предустановлен с 14.04. Вы найдете полную информацию о вашем дистрибутиве на сайте Snapcraft,
Установить snapdиспользуйте следующую команду терминала:
Дождитесь завершения установки, прежде чем продолжить. Обратите внимание, что хотя snapd запускается или предварительно устанавливается с указанными выше дистрибутивами, Anbox официально поддерживается на:
- Ubuntu 16.04 LTS (Xenial Xerxes)
- Ubuntu 18.04 LTS (Бионический Бобр)
В последующих выпусках Ubuntu также должен работать Anbox. Эта поддержка означает, что вы, вероятно, получите лучшие результаты при запуске приложений Android в Ubuntu, чем в других дистрибутивах.
Установка Anbox в Linux
С snapd служба установлена на вашем ПК с Linux, вы готовы установить Anbox. Используйте следующую команду, которая устанавливает все, что вам нужно:
При появлении запроса введите пароль, и пакет снимков будет загружен.
Вскоре после этого вы увидите выбор:
- Установить Anbox
- Удалить Anbox
Если вам потребуется удалить программное обеспечение позже, просто повторно запустите указанную выше команду установщика и выберите вариант 2. Однако в случае установки Anbox вы можете перейти к варианту 1.
После этого вы увидите сводную информацию о том, что будет делать установка. Найдите минутку, чтобы прочитать это.
Вы увидите, что файлы добавлены из списка PPA. Также должно быть уведомление о том, что Anbox Runtime будет автоматически запускаться при входе в Linux. (Это библиотека программного обеспечения, которая позволяет запускать другие программы и приложения.)
Если вас все это устраивает, введите Я СОГЛАСЕН и подождите, пока Anbox установит. После этого следуйте инструкциям, чтобы перезагрузить систему, прежде чем продолжить.
Загрузка файлов APK на компьютер с Linux
После перезагрузки компьютера Anbox будет доступен в меню рабочего стола. Нажмите на нее, чтобы запустить — вы скоро увидите окно Anbox.
Если ничего не происходит, или вы застряли на заставке с начало сообщение, отмените или подождите, пока это не закончится. Затем откройте новый терминал и введите
Затем снова щелкните значок в меню. Через несколько мгновений Anbox должен запуститься. Это известная ошибка в дистрибутивах на основе Ubuntu 16.04, которая не должна затрагивать более поздние дистрибутивы.
С запущенной Anbox вы увидите список основных приложений Android, которые вы можете запустить в Linux, таких как Календарь и Электронная почта. Просто щелкните левой кнопкой мыши по этим значкам, чтобы открыть их; они появятся в новых окнах, размер которых можно изменить по мере необходимости. Если вам нужен браузер, оболочка WebView включена.
Чтобы добавить свои собственные приложения и игры, все, что вам нужно сделать, это загрузить (или скопировать с другого устройства) соответствующие файлы APK
, Это установочные файлы, такие как файлы DEB (или снимки) в Linux или файлы EXE в Windows.
На телефонах и таблицах Android файлы APK доступны через Google Play на Android … но это не относится к Anbox.
Установка приложений Android в Linux с помощью Anbox
Поскольку реализация Anbox для Android не зарегистрирована, вы не сможете получить доступ к Google Play (или установить его). Итак, как вы можете запускать приложения Android в Ubuntu и других дистрибутивах Linux с Anbox?
Поэтому ответом является загрузка и загрузка APK. Вы найдете их через альтернативы Google Play
, но вы также можете извлечь APK из Google Play
Хотя Google ограничивает доступ к Play Store только зарегистрированным устройствам Android, в обход этого не идет пиратство. Если у вас уже есть файлы APK или они доступны бесплатно, можно запускать их на незарегистрированных устройствах Android.
После того, как вы получите все APK-файлы, которые хотите установить, вам нужно разрешить установку из неизвестных источников. Сделайте это, открыв настройки меню на экране приложений, затем найдите Безопасность. Включить переключатель рядом с Неизвестные источники и нажмите Ok принять.
После этого найдите файлы APK и дважды щелкните первый файл, который хотите установить. Через несколько секунд приложение или игра должны быть готовы и будут запущены в своем собственном окне. Установленные игры перечислены вместе со всеми другими приложениями для Linux.
Запускать приложения для Android в Linux — это просто!
Теперь вы можете запустить Android APK на Linux
Поскольку Anbox находится на стадии альфа, могут быть некоторые проблемы со стабильностью. Тем не менее, приятно знать, насколько просто настроить, установить и запустить приложения Android в Linux Ubuntu с Anbox.
- Убедитесь, что ваш дистрибутив поддерживает мгновенные пакеты.
- Установите или обновите snapd служба.
- Установите Anbox.
- Запустите Anbox с вашего рабочего стола Linux.
- Скачайте APK файлы и запустите их.
- Подождите, пока установится APK-файл.
- Нажмите, чтобы запустить приложения Android на рабочем столе Linux.
Anbox — не единственный способ запуска приложений и игр для Android в Linux
Но мы рассчитываем, что он станет самым популярным через несколько лет. А чтобы пойти другим путем, узнайте, как запустить Linux на вашем Android-устройстве.
Источник